Bmwn_and Caldwel�� <br /> &Dnsuitants <br /> 723 S Street <br /> Sacramenro <br /> California 95814-7092 <br /> (916)444-0123 <br /> FAX{9181444-8437 <br /> 1k B <br /> August 14 1991 mn E tdft;E I Vy From Iff) <br /> AUG 15 1991 <br /> ENVIRONMENTAL HEALTH <br /> Mr. John Reed <br /> PERMIT/SFERVICES <br /> Field Engineer <br /> Cal Trans w <br /> 1120 N Street <br /> Sacramento, California 95814 017-5380-01/1 <br /> Subject: Encroachment Permit Application Request for Connection to the Industrial <br /> Waste Line Located at 501 West Kettleman Lane, Lodi, California <br /> ARCO Station 434, Site Code: 1341 <br /> Dear Mr. Reed: <br /> JE <br /> On behalf of ARCO Products Company, Brown and Caldwell Consultants requests an <br /> encroachment permit application for connection to an existing industrial waste line. <br /> The groundwater beneath 501 West Kettleman Lane is impacted with gasoline hydrocarbons. <br /> Remediation of hydrocarbon-affected soil and groundwater is required by the California Regional <br /> Water Quality Control Board, the City of Lodi, and San Joaquin County. Currently, there is a <br /> soil vapor extraction and treatment system that is operating to remove hydrocarbons in the soil <br /> vapor. Groundwater will be remediated by extraction and treatment. The treatment system will <br /> remove all organic hydrocarbons to levels at or below California drinking water standards. The <br /> initial extraction rates are anticipated to be 2 gallons per minute or less. <br /> Accordingly, discharge of the clean water-from the extraction and treatment system has been <br /> proposed to be at the industrial waste line located in Kettleman Lane (please see City of Lodi <br /> correspondence of June 26, 1991, enclosed). The existing 30-inch industrial line carries water <br /> that is primarily cannery waste and is used for irrigation at the City of Lodi treatment plant. It <br /> is our understanding that the City of Lodi owns the industrial line and discharge will be regulated <br /> by the City. <br /> We are anxious to initiate the permitting process for making connection to the existing industrial <br /> line. The principal reason for expediting the connection is to remove and treat contamination <br /> from the site so that a nearby City of Lodi municipal may be reactivated. <br /> .If <br />
